Specifications of the Martin D-10E

The Martin D-10E boasts impressive specifications that contribute to its exceptional sound and playability. This dreadnought acoustic guitar features a solid Sitka spruce top, which provides a balanced tone with rich resonance. The back and sides are crafted from sapele, a tonewood known for its warm and clear characteristics. The neck is made from select hardwood and is shaped in a modified low oval profile, ensuring comfortable playability for hours on end.

With a scale length of 25.4 inches, the Martin D-10E offers a familiar feel to those accustomed to playing dreadnought guitars. The fingerboard is constructed from Richlite, a durable and environmentally friendly material that resembles ebony in both appearance and performance. The guitar also comes equipped with a Fishman MX-T electronics system, allowing for effortless amplification when needed.

Features of the D-10E

The Martin D-10E is packed with features that enhance its overall performance and versatility. One notable feature is the high-performance tapered bracing, which provides excellent resonance and projection. This bracing pattern is unique to Martin and has been carefully designed to optimize the guitar’s tonal qualities.

Another standout feature of the D-10E is the modern belly bridge, which not only adds an aesthetic touch but also contributes to improved sustain and clarity. The bridge pins are made from white Tusq, a material known for enhancing the guitar’s harmonics and overall tone.

The Martin D-10E also features an attractive satin finish, giving it a natural and organic look. The satin finish not only enhances the guitar’s visual appeal but also allows the wood to breathe and resonate freely, resulting in a more open and vibrant sound.

Overview of the Martin D-10E

In terms of playability, the Martin D-10E excels. The low action and smooth neck profile make it a joy to play, whether you’re strumming chords or playing intricate fingerstyle melodies. The guitar produces a well-balanced and rich tone, with clear highs, warm mids, and a tight low end. It offers great projection and volume, making it suitable for both solo performances and ensemble playing.

The Fishman MX-T electronics system is a welcome addition, allowing you to plug in and amplify the guitar’s natural sound without sacrificing its tonal integrity. The controls for volume and tone are discreetly mounted inside the soundhole, providing easy access while maintaining a clean and unobtrusive appearance.
